A lot of questions for one post. If you install a mod manually, the mod managers have no idea how to uninstall it. They will only be aware of the plugins. For uninstalling mods with special instructions, you will have to read the description provided by the mod author to see if there is any mention of using stopquest or other command to stop any scripts that were added by the mod. If you find such instructions for a mod you have already removed, you may be able to re-install the mod, then execute the command, then uninstall it again.

 

I don't know about mannequins, but if you have mods dependent on FNIS, then the generator does need to be run everytime you install, update, or uninstall an animation mod. I would check the AH mod page to see if the author mentions anything related to FNIS and animations. If not, you might try posting a question in that mod's comment topic.

 

The hair mod may be installed correctly. Some of them have some odd behaviour due to choices made to soften the edges, etc., which can cause odd appearance under certain lighting conditions, including turning black, becoming transparent. It has something to do with the alpha settings. If you post pictures of some of the hair, I'm sure people would recognize which mod it is.

Adding to Blitzen's post, for your future reference.

Manually installed mods, unzipped and added to your data folder, are not managed by NMM. However, if you place the ZIP file (unextracted) into the NMM mods folder: C:/Games/NexusModManager/Skyrim/Mods, then it will appear on the mods page (unactivated) in NMM. You just click to activate, and it's like a regular mod downloaded by NMM.
